Witryna26 maj 2024 · Unlike missing the 60-day rollover deadline, violating the once-per-year rule is a mistake that cannot be fixed. But the once-per-year rule is often misunderstood. As background, remember that the once-per-year rule only applies to traditional IRA-to-traditional IRA rollovers or Roth IRA-to-Roth IRA rollovers. The rule does not apply … Witryna13 sty 2024 · The IRS only allows one rollover from an IRA to another IRA (or the same IRA) in any 12-month period, regardless of how many IRAs you own.
